October Toys OMFG Series 4 Five New "Outlandish Mini Figure Guys"... October Toys announces the launch of the OMFG Series 4 Kickstarter (kickstarter.com/projects/georgegaspar/omfg-series-4). For those unfamiliar, OMFG (Outlandish Mini Figure Guys) is a series of small, approximately 2 inch tall collectible PVC figures that are inspired by the M.U.S.C.L.E. phenomenom of the Eighties. So far three assortments have been successfully funded and produced (read our OMFG! Series 3 review HERE). OMFG Series 4 consists of five figures including: Fossil Freak designed by Michael Stearns from Washington and sculpted by George Gaspar from CaliforniaWooly Wisp designed and sculpted by Billy Parker from South CarolinaBullseye designed by (Raging Nerdgasm) Tom Khayos and Ana Bruja-Khayos from Florida sculpted by George Gaspar from CaliforniaTree Witched designed by MudMarox and sculpted by GormTransMonster from ItalyThe Siren designed by Corey Webb from California and sculpted by George Gaspar from California A pledge of $12 (up $2 from previous waves, but still very affordable) will get you one set of flesh colored OMFG! Series 4 figures (the figures pictured are the resin prototypes, thus their odd color). Exclusive to the Kickstarter are the five figures in black. The OMFG Series 4 Kickstarter has a goal of $16K with over $6000 already pledged. If the past three assortments are any indication, OMFG Series 4 should have no problem reaching its goal 24 days from now.
